Indianapolis has Fun Family Activities





Indiana can get very hot and humid during the summer months. However, it is also home to several family friendly activities. You can find outdoor activities, indoor attractions and water parks. These are some great things to do in Indianapolis for children.

The Children's Museum of Indianapolis (the Children's Museum of Indianapolis) is the largest children's museum on earth, featuring five floors of interactive exhibits. There is something for everyone: a play structure, a space exploration area, an outdoor sports area, and an antique carousel. You can also check out special exhibits.
